Nevada Estate Planning Rules
Creating a will in Nevada comes with specific requirements. While My Last Word handles the heavy lifting, it's important to understand the local laws that protect your legacy.
Witness Requirements
Two competent witnesses
Probate Threshold
Estates under $25,000 (for setting aside without administration) may qualify for simplified procedures.
Specific Laws You Should Know
Electronic Wills
Nevada was one of the first states to legalize electronic wills (e-wills) that are written, signed, and stored in an electronic record. My Last Word helps you prepare documents that meet these cutting-edge standards.
No State Estate Tax
Nevada is tax-friendly and does not impose a state-level estate or inheritance tax, making it an attractive place for establishing trusts and estate plans.
